Wind energy firms have approached the Appellate Tribunal for Electricity to ensure enforcement of the renewable purchase obligations, complaining that the regulators have failed to penalise those found guilty of non-compliance.

Indian Wind Energy Association and Indian Wind Turbine Manufacturers Association have jointly petitioned against all 25 state electricity regulatory commissions, two joint electricity regulatory commissions, Central Electricity Regulatory Commission and the forum of regulators. The two associations have wind energy generators, developers and equipment manufacturers as their members.

Rising petroleum prices are expected to benefit renewable energy solution providers as commercial establishments that use diesel generator sets for their captive requirements may find solar power attractive. The city gas distribution (CGD) players too expect commercial establishments to switch from diesel to piped natural gas in the areas where power supply is unreliable.
